Home
last modified time | relevance | path

Searched refs:spmi (Results 1 – 25 of 161) sorted by relevance

1234567

/openbmc/linux/Documentation/devicetree/bindings/spmi/
H A Dhisilicon,hisi-spmi-controller.yaml4 $id: http://devicetree.org/schemas/spmi/hisilicon,hisi-spmi-controller.yaml#
17 Documentation/devicetree/bindings/mfd/hisilicon,hi6421-spmi-pmic.yaml.
20 - $ref: spmi.yaml#
25 pattern: "spmi@[0-9a-f]"
28 const: hisilicon,kirin970-spmi-controller
33 hisilicon,spmi-channel:
41 - hisilicon,spmi-channel
51 Documentation/devicetree/bindings/mfd/hisilicon,hi6421-spmi-pmic.yaml
61 spmi: spmi@fff24000 {
62 compatible = "hisilicon,kirin970-spmi-controller";
[all …]
H A Dmtk,spmi-mtk-pmif.yaml4 $id: http://devicetree.org/schemas/spmi/mtk,spmi-mtk-pmif.yaml#
17 - $ref: spmi.yaml
23 - mediatek,mt6873-spmi
24 - mediatek,mt8195-spmi
27 - mediatek,mt8186-spmi
28 - const: mediatek,mt8195-spmi
67 spmi: spmi@10027000 {
68 compatible = "mediatek,mt6873-spmi";
/openbmc/linux/arch/arm64/boot/dts/qcom/
H A Dsc8180x-pmics.dtsi9 #include <dt-bindings/spmi/spmi.h>
10 #include <dt-bindings/iio/qcom,spmi-vadc.h>
72 compatible = "qcom,pm8150", "qcom,spmi-pmic";
92 compatible = "qcom,spmi-temp-alarm";
101 compatible = "qcom,spmi-adc5";
128 compatible = "qcom,spmi-adc-tm5";
169 compatible = "qcom,spmi-adc-rev2";
217 compatible = "qcom,spmi-adc-rev2";
258 compatible = "qcom,spmi-temp-alarm";
267 compatible = "qcom,spmi-adc5";
[all …]
H A Dpm8550vs.dtsi7 #include <dt-bindings/spmi/spmi.h>
100 compatible = "qcom,pm8550", "qcom,spmi-pmic";
106 compatible = "qcom,spmi-temp-alarm";
113 compatible = "qcom,pm8550vs-gpio", "qcom,spmi-gpio";
124 compatible = "qcom,pm8550", "qcom,spmi-pmic";
130 compatible = "qcom,spmi-temp-alarm";
137 compatible = "qcom,pm8550vs-gpio", "qcom,spmi-gpio";
148 compatible = "qcom,pm8550", "qcom,spmi-pmic";
154 compatible = "qcom,spmi-temp-alarm";
172 compatible = "qcom,pm8550", "qcom,spmi-pmic";
[all …]
H A Dsa8540p-pmics.dtsi8 #include <dt-bindings/spmi/spmi.h>
12 compatible = "qcom,pm8150", "qcom,spmi-pmic";
26 compatible = "qcom,pm8150-gpio", "qcom,spmi-gpio";
37 compatible = "qcom,pm8150", "qcom,spmi-pmic";
43 compatible = "qcom,spmi-sdam";
52 compatible = "qcom,pm8150-gpio", "qcom,spmi-gpio";
63 compatible = "qcom,pm8150", "qcom,spmi-pmic";
69 compatible = "qcom,pm8150-gpio", "qcom,spmi-gpio";
80 compatible = "qcom,pm8150", "qcom,spmi-pmic";
86 compatible = "qcom,pm8150-gpio", "qcom,spmi-gpio";
H A Dsc8280xp-pmics.dtsi8 #include <dt-bindings/spmi/spmi.h>
56 compatible = "qcom,pmk8350", "qcom,spmi-pmic";
81 compatible = "qcom,spmi-adc7";
91 compatible = "qcom,spmi-adc-tm5-gen2";
110 compatible = "qcom,spmi-sdam";
120 compatible = "qcom,pm8350", "qcom,spmi-pmic";
126 compatible = "qcom,spmi-temp-alarm";
144 compatible = "qcom,pm8350c", "qcom,spmi-pmic";
172 compatible = "qcom,pm8350", "qcom,spmi-pmic";
178 compatible = "qcom,spmi-temp-alarm";
[all …]
H A Dsa8775p-pmics.dtsi7 #include <dt-bindings/spmi/spmi.h>
103 compatible = "qcom,pmm8654au", "qcom,spmi-pmic";
109 compatible = "qcom,spmi-temp-alarm";
136 compatible = "qcom,pmm8654au-gpio", "qcom,spmi-gpio";
146 compatible = "qcom,spmi-sdam";
160 compatible = "qcom,pmm8654au", "qcom,spmi-pmic";
166 compatible = "qcom,spmi-temp-alarm";
184 compatible = "qcom,pmm8654au", "qcom,spmi-pmic";
190 compatible = "qcom,spmi-temp-alarm";
208 compatible = "qcom,pmm8654au", "qcom,spmi-pmic";
[all …]
H A Dpm6150l.dtsi6 #include <dt-bindings/iio/qcom,spmi-vadc.h>
8 #include <dt-bindings/spmi/spmi.h>
43 compatible = "qcom,pm6150l", "qcom,spmi-pmic";
49 compatible = "qcom,spmi-temp-alarm";
56 compatible = "qcom,spmi-adc5";
89 compatible = "qcom,spmi-adc-tm5";
99 compatible = "qcom,pm6150l-gpio", "qcom,spmi-gpio";
110 compatible = "qcom,pm6150l", "qcom,spmi-pmic";
116 compatible = "qcom,pm6150l-flash-led", "qcom,spmi-flash-led";
H A Dpm8150l.dtsi7 #include <dt-bindings/iio/qcom,spmi-vadc.h>
9 #include <dt-bindings/spmi/spmi.h>
44 compatible = "qcom,pm8150l", "qcom,spmi-pmic";
57 compatible = "qcom,spmi-temp-alarm";
66 compatible = "qcom,spmi-adc5";
93 compatible = "qcom,spmi-adc-tm5";
103 compatible = "qcom,pm8150l-gpio", "qcom,spmi-gpio";
114 compatible = "qcom,pm8150l", "qcom,spmi-pmic";
120 compatible = "qcom,pm8150l-flash-led", "qcom,spmi-flash-led";
H A Dpmr735d.dtsi7 #include <dt-bindings/spmi/spmi.h>
58 compatible = "qcom,pmr735d", "qcom,spmi-pmic";
64 compatible = "qcom,spmi-temp-alarm";
71 compatible = "qcom,pmr735d-gpio", "qcom,spmi-gpio";
82 compatible = "qcom,pmr735d", "qcom,spmi-pmic";
88 compatible = "qcom,spmi-temp-alarm";
95 compatible = "qcom,pmr735d-gpio", "qcom,spmi-gpio";
H A Dpm6150.dtsi6 #include <dt-bindings/iio/qcom,spmi-vadc.h>
9 #include <dt-bindings/spmi/spmi.h>
38 compatible = "qcom,pm6150", "qcom,spmi-pmic";
59 compatible = "qcom,spmi-temp-alarm";
68 compatible = "qcom,spmi-adc5";
82 compatible = "qcom,spmi-adc-tm5";
92 compatible = "qcom,pm6150-gpio", "qcom,spmi-gpio";
103 compatible = "qcom,pm6150", "qcom,spmi-pmic";
H A Dpmi632.dtsi6 #include <dt-bindings/iio/qcom,spmi-vadc.h>
8 #include <dt-bindings/spmi/spmi.h>
43 compatible = "qcom,pmi632", "qcom,spmi-pmic";
49 compatible = "qcom,spmi-temp-alarm";
56 compatible = "qcom,spmi-adc5";
121 compatible = "qcom,spmi-adc-tm5";
131 compatible = "qcom,spmi-sdam";
139 compatible = "qcom,pmi632-gpio", "qcom,spmi-gpio";
150 compatible = "qcom,pmi632", "qcom,spmi-pmic";
H A Dpm8150b.dtsi7 #include <dt-bindings/iio/qcom,spmi-vadc.h>
9 #include <dt-bindings/spmi/spmi.h>
44 compatible = "qcom,pm8150b", "qcom,spmi-pmic";
63 compatible = "qcom,spmi-temp-alarm";
72 compatible = "qcom,spmi-adc5";
105 compatible = "qcom,spmi-adc-tm5";
115 compatible = "qcom,pm8150b-gpio", "qcom,spmi-gpio";
126 compatible = "qcom,pm8150b", "qcom,spmi-pmic";
H A Dpmm8155au_1.dtsi8 #include <dt-bindings/spmi/spmi.h>
9 #include <dt-bindings/iio/qcom,spmi-vadc.h>
44 compatible = "qcom,pmm8155au", "qcom,spmi-pmic";
64 compatible = "qcom,spmi-temp-alarm";
73 compatible = "qcom,spmi-adc5";
100 compatible = "qcom,spmi-adc-tm5";
119 compatible = "qcom,pmm8155au-gpio", "qcom,spmi-gpio";
130 compatible = "qcom,pmm8155au", "qcom,spmi-pmic";
H A Dpmi8950.dtsi4 #include <dt-bindings/iio/qcom,spmi-vadc.h>
6 #include <dt-bindings/spmi/spmi.h>
10 compatible = "qcom,pmi8950", "qcom,spmi-pmic";
16 compatible = "qcom,spmi-vadc";
61 compatible = "qcom,pmi8950-mpp", "qcom,spmi-mpp";
71 compatible = "qcom,pmi8950-gpio", "qcom,spmi-gpio";
82 compatible = "qcom,pmi8950", "qcom,spmi-pmic";
H A Dpm8998.dtsi4 #include <dt-bindings/iio/qcom,spmi-vadc.h>
7 #include <dt-bindings/spmi/spmi.h>
36 compatible = "qcom,pm8998", "qcom,spmi-pmic";
66 compatible = "qcom,spmi-temp-alarm";
82 compatible = "qcom,spmi-adc-rev2";
96 compatible = "qcom,spmi-adc-tm-hc";
113 compatible = "qcom,pm8998-gpio", "qcom,spmi-gpio";
125 compatible = "qcom,pm8998", "qcom,spmi-pmic";
H A Dpm660l.dtsi6 #include <dt-bindings/iio/qcom,spmi-vadc.h>
9 #include <dt-bindings/spmi/spmi.h>
39 compatible = "qcom,pm660l", "qcom,spmi-pmic";
45 compatible = "qcom,spmi-temp-alarm";
52 compatible = "qcom,pm660l-gpio", "qcom,spmi-gpio";
63 compatible = "qcom,pm660l", "qcom,spmi-pmic";
H A Dpm7250b.dtsi6 #include <dt-bindings/iio/qcom,spmi-vadc.h>
8 #include <dt-bindings/spmi/spmi.h>
43 compatible = "qcom,pm7250b", "qcom,spmi-pmic";
49 compatible = "qcom,spmi-temp-alarm";
58 compatible = "qcom,spmi-adc5";
142 compatible = "qcom,spmi-adc-tm5";
152 compatible = "qcom,pm7250b-gpio", "qcom,spmi-gpio";
163 compatible = "qcom,pm7250b", "qcom,spmi-pmic";
/openbmc/linux/Documentation/devicetree/bindings/mfd/
H A Dqcom,spmi-pmic.yaml4 $id: http://devicetree.org/schemas/mfd/qcom,spmi-pmic.yaml#
96 - const: qcom,spmi-pmic
149 $ref: /schemas/leds/qcom,spmi-flash-led.yaml#
153 $ref: /schemas/nvmem/qcom,spmi-sdam.yaml#
216 #include <dt-bindings/spmi/spmi.h>
220 spmi@c440000 {
221 compatible = "qcom,spmi-pmic-arb";
259 #include <dt-bindings/iio/qcom,spmi-vadc.h>
260 #include <dt-bindings/spmi/spmi.h>
293 compatible = "qcom,spmi-adc5";
[all …]
/openbmc/linux/arch/arm/boot/dts/qcom/
H A Dpma8084.dtsi2 #include <dt-bindings/iio/qcom,spmi-vadc.h>
4 #include <dt-bindings/spmi/spmi.h>
9 compatible = "qcom,pma8084", "qcom,spmi-pmic";
31 compatible = "qcom,pma8084-gpio", "qcom,spmi-gpio";
41 compatible = "qcom,pma8084-mpp", "qcom,spmi-mpp";
51 compatible = "qcom,spmi-temp-alarm";
60 compatible = "qcom,spmi-vadc";
94 compatible = "qcom,pma8084", "qcom,spmi-pmic";
H A Dpmx55.dtsi8 #include <dt-bindings/iio/qcom,spmi-vadc.h>
10 #include <dt-bindings/spmi/spmi.h>
14 compatible = "qcom,pmx55", "qcom,spmi-pmic";
27 compatible = "qcom,spmi-temp-alarm";
36 compatible = "qcom,spmi-adc5";
69 compatible = "qcom,pmx55-gpio", "qcom,spmi-gpio";
80 compatible = "qcom,pmx55", "qcom,spmi-pmic";
H A Dpm8841.dtsi3 #include <dt-bindings/spmi/spmi.h>
39 compatible = "qcom,pm8841", "qcom,spmi-pmic";
45 compatible = "qcom,pm8841-mpp", "qcom,spmi-mpp";
55 compatible = "qcom,spmi-temp-alarm";
63 compatible = "qcom,pm8841", "qcom,spmi-pmic";
/openbmc/linux/Documentation/devicetree/bindings/iio/adc/
H A Dqcom,spmi-vadc.yaml24 - const: qcom,spmi-adc-rev2
26 - qcom,spmi-vadc
27 - qcom,spmi-adc5
28 - qcom,spmi-adc-rev2
29 - qcom,spmi-adc7
117 - For compatible property "qcom,spmi-adc5", "qcom,spmi-adc7" and
147 const: qcom,spmi-vadc
193 const: qcom,spmi-adc5
216 const: qcom,spmi-adc7
239 spmi {
[all …]
/openbmc/u-boot/doc/device-tree-bindings/spmi/
H A Dspmi-sandbox.txt6 - compatible: "sandbox,spmi"
12 spmi: spmi@0 {
13 compatible = "sandbox,spmi";
17 compatible = "qcom,spmi-pmic";
28 gpio-bank-name="spmi";
/openbmc/linux/arch/arm64/boot/dts/hisilicon/
H A Dhikey970-pmic.dtsi8 #include <dt-bindings/spmi/spmi.h>
11 spmi: spmi@fff24000 { label
12 compatible = "hisilicon,kirin970-spmi-controller";
17 hisilicon,spmi-channel = <2>;
20 compatible = "hisilicon,hi6421-spmi";

1234567